Engine Spluttering Then Limp Mode?
So just now, I started my car, and immediately it sounded horrible. The engine was spluttering and it sounded like it was about to die anytime. It would randomly rev up to 2.5k and then come back down to 800. Then on the nav screen, it says "Engine Malfunction, Reduced Power."
When I opened the hood, there was foam everywhere, it came from the foam cover thing on the hood. I'm pretty sure a rodent got in and started gnawing at my engine harness. Any idea what parts he chewed up? or what else could have happened? I'm having it towed to Sterling BMW in Newport Beach. Hopefully, they can fix it ASAP. Oh yeah, I have no engine mods.

I guarantee the issue is your spark plugs. I just had the EXACT same problem. I took it into the dealer, and they replaced all six fuel injectors and upgraded the software. Doing so made the idle a little better and it didn't throw a code, however when I put my tune back in that has a 4 degree timing advance at idle, the issue came back immediately. I replaced the plugs this weekend by myself and the issue is completely resolved-- tuned or valet mode (stock).

Got the car back today.
They switched out spark plugs and fuel injectors. One of the cylinders was misfiring. Anyways, the car runs great again My SA says that I should take some precaution with the rodents because they did see some chewing on different parts of the engine.
